Formed in 1971, this South Carolina unit rode the Allman Brothers-led southern-rock trend to great commercial success in the mid-'70s. Adding a bit more twang (Toy Caldwell's riffs recalled Duane Eddy) and jazzy elements (via Jerry Eubanks's sax and flute) to the mix, MTB had its biggest hit in 1975 with "Heard It in a Love Song" from their Searchin' for a Rainbow LP. Waylon Jennings subsequently scored a hit with their "Can't You See," but the band never recovered from the deaths of the Caldwell brothers.
